Toronto police officer found guilty of misconduct during G20 summit

In reasons released today by the Hon. Walter Gonet, Hearing Officer, Toronto Police Constable Bejamin Ardiles was found to have committed an unlawful and unnecessary arrest of the complainant, Mr. Michael Williams, during the events of the G20 summit held in Toronto in June, 2010.  8aixat lawyers Brendan van Niejenhuis and Edward Marrocco acted as counsel for the Prosecution at the hearing.  To read the decision, click here.
